I can't reproduce this using a 2-days old CVS 0.70. I always get a visible font for any 0.65 original style. According to /etc/fonts/fonts.conf, fontconfig always aliases sans-serif (as well as "sans" and "sans serif") to a probably well thought out selection of (currently) 14 fonts.
